Higuain eyes Reds scalp

23 February 2009 14:20
Gonzalo Higuain is confident that Real Madrid can establish a first leg lead in their meeting with Liverpool.[LNB] The two European heavyweights are set to go head-to-head at Santiago Bernabeu on Wednesday in the last 16 of the UEFA Champions League.[LNB]Real have been eliminated at this stage of the competition in each of the last four seasons and are desperate to bring an end to that sorry sequence of results.[LNB]The omens look good, with a comprehensive 6-1 mauling of Real Betis on Sunday suggesting Juande Ramos' men will enter their midweek encounter in high spirits.[LNB]"Now, after this win, we have to focus on the next game. Now it's the Champions League and we have to continue like this," said Higuain.[LNB]"We have to continue like that and remain strong mentally because there are some very important games coming up, the first of which is against Liverpool.[LNB]"Wednesday's game is another 'final'. It's going to be a very tough game against a very accomplished team who do very well in these sorts of ties.[LNB]"But Madrid are Madrid and this is always a bonus for us. We are going to work as hard as we can and we hope to pick up a positive result to take into the second leg.[LNB]"Fans need to come and support us. We're going to give everything on the pitch and I'm sure that we are going to give them a victory against Liverpool."[LNB]ClassicMeanwhile, Real's Portuguese defender Pepe is expecting a close contest between too evenly-matched sides.[LNB]"It is a European classic and I think that it will be interesting for us to see where we are," the centre-half said in Marca.[LNB]"I think Liverpool will come here to defend and we will have to be very focused on not losing the ball while keeping the pressure high and not allowing their best players any space.[LNB]"It will be a good duel with Fernando Torres and I expect that I will have to talk to Fabio (Cannavaro) a lot to organise the defence, but I think that we can stop him.[LNB]"Torres is a great player and has incredible quality. He is strong and quick and we will have to be at our best and always trying to think before he does."[LNB]
